Subject: Handover — ValidatorForge plugin rollout

Hey, taking off for the week, so here's where things stand. The ValidatorForge plugin loader shipped to staging on Tuesday; third-party validator plugins now register through the manifest scanner instead of the old hardcoded list. Two plugins (schema-strict and dedupe-lite) still fail checksum verification intermittently — restart the loader if you see that. Everything you deploy needs to be signed before the registry accepts it. Use the key below for that step.

signing key of bagap-yawep = bky13_TbfT6ZMUoGJo2

**Q: Why did SQL lint fail on my migration?**

A: The Drossvale linter now enforces uppercase keywords, explicit column lists, and no SELECT * in committed files. Covered at last sync; rules live in the shared config. Override requires a lint-waiver tag plus reviewer sign-off. If CI blocks you mid-release, use the break-glass bypass in the lint vault, unlocked with the passphrase below.

unlock words, fafop-hawep: briwyn-oliix-sorox

Subject: Cut-over to incremental rebuilds complete

Hi all — welcome aboard. As of Tuesday, the Wrenfield docs site uses incremental static rebuilds via the Kindlecrest builder instead of full nightly builds. Average rebuild time dropped from 40 minutes to under 3. Rollback instructions live in the runbook. For reference, the builder now runs in production with the following configuration.

deployment values, bahof-badug:
[rusix]
team = zorok
access_code = ac_641cbe
owner = ulair.tamius
host = rusix.torvasoft.local
port = 5672
peer = ulaix.sivrelworks.internal
salt = 1df570ed
pin = 6327

Welcome to the Quillbarn config service! Good news: you almost never need to redeploy. Edit values in the console and the watcher hot-reloads them within ten seconds. If the watcher itself wedges, restart it from the Larkspin dashboard. To unlock the dashboard's emergency mode, use the recovery passphrase shown below.

unlock words, yawig-kagef: gordor-holvan-ulaael-pramir-ulaiel-tamdor